NAME¶
XbaeCaption - The Bellcore Application Environment (BAE) XbaeCaption widget
class.
SYNOPSIS¶
#include <Xbae/Caption.h>
DESCRIPTION¶
XbaeCaption is a simple manager used to associate a label with its single
child. The label may be either an
XmString or a Pixmap and can be
displayed in any one of twelve positions around the edge of the child.
XbaeCaption performs geometry management so that its size always
matches its child's size plus the size of the label and label offset. By using
XbaeCaption with an
XmFrame child, groups of related widgets can
be labeled in a visually appealing manner.
XbaeCaption is also useful
for associating labels with individual
XmTextFields.
Classes¶
XbaeCaption inherits behavior and resources from the
Core,
Composite,
Constraint and
XmManager widget classes.
The class pointer is
xbaeCaptionWidgetClass.
The class name is
XbaeCaption.

- XmNfontList
- Specifies the font of the text used in the caption label.
If this value is NULL at initialization, it is initialized
by looking up the parent hierarchy of the widget for an ancestor that is a
subclass of the XmBulletinBoard, VendorShell or
XmMenuShell widget class. If such an ancestor is found, the font
list is initialized to the appropriate default font list of the ancestor
widget XmNdefaultFontList for VendorShell and
XmMenuShell, XmNlabelFontList or XmNbuttonFontList
for XmBulletinBoard. Refer to XmFontList(3X) for more
information on the creation and structure of a font list. This resource is
copied.
- XmNlabelAlignment
- Specifies the alignment of the caption label along the side
of the caption child. Must be one of the enumerated
XbaeLabelAlignment types: XbaeAlignmentTopOrLeft,
XbaeAlignmentCenter, XbaeAlignmentBottomOrRight.
- XmNlabelOffset
- Specifies the offset, in pixels, of the caption label from
the caption child. If the offset is negative, then the caption label will
overlap the caption child by that many pixels.
- XmNlabelPixmap
- Specifies the caption label pixmap when XmNlabelType
is XmPIXMAP.
- XmNlabelPosition
- Specifies on which side of the caption child the caption
label should be placed. Must be one of the enumerated
XbaeLabelPosition types: XbaePositionLeft,
XbaePositionRight, XbaePositionTop,
XbaePositionBottom.
- XmNlabelString
- Specifies the compound string when the XmNlabelType
is XmSTRING. If this value is NULL, it is
initialized by converting the name of the widget to a compound string.
Refer to XmString(3X) for more information on the creation and
structure of compound strings.
- XmNlabelTextAlignment
- Specifies the text alignment for the caption label. This
resource is only useful for multi line caption labels. Valid values are:
XmALIGNMENT_BEGINNING left alignment causes the left sides of the
lines of text to be vertically aligned. XmALIGNMENT_CENTER center
alignment causes the centers of the lines of text to be vertically
aligned. XmALIGNMENT_END right alignment causes the right sides of
the lines of text to be vertically aligned.
- XmNlabelType
- Specifies the caption label type. Valid values are:
XmSTRING - the caption label will display the
XmNlabelString. XmPIXMAP - the caption label will display
the XmNlabelPixmap.

Type Converters¶
In addition to the standard type converters registered by Xt and Motif,
XbaeCaption registers the following additional type converters:
- CvtStringToLabelAlignment()
- Converts a String to the enumerated
XbaeLabelAlignment type. The Strings TopOrLeft, Top
and Left are converted to XbaeAlignmentTopOrLeft. The String
Center is converted to XbaeAlignmentCenter. The Strings
BottomOrRight, Bottom and Right are converted to
XbaeAlignmentBottomOrRight. This converter allows the
XmNlabelAlignment resource to be specified in a resource file. The
converter is case insensitive.
- CvtStringToLabelPosition()
- Converts a String to the enumerated
XbaeLabelPosition type. The String Left is converted to
XbaePositionLeft. The String Right is converted to
XbaePositionRight. The String Top is converted to
XbaePositionTop. The String Bottom is converted to
XbaePositionBottom. This converter allows the
XmNlabelPosition resource to be specified in a resource file. The
converter is case insensitive.
Public Functions¶
The following external entry points to
XbaeCaption class methods are
defined:
XbaeCreateCaption()

- parent
- Specifies the parent widget ID.
- name
- Specifies the name of the created widget
- arglist
- Specifies the argument list
- argcount
- Specifies the number of attribute/value pairs in the
argument list (arglist)
XbaeCreateCaption() creates an instance of an XbaeCaption widget and
returns the associated widget ID.
